The Broadway Education Alliance is pleased to announce that Tony Award-winner Bonnie Milligan, will host the 2023-24 Roger Rees Awards for Excellence in Student Performance on Sunday, May 19, 2024 at The Gerald W. Lynch Theatre at John Jay College.

Co-sponsored by Disney Theatrical Group and the Broadway production of Back to the Future, this year’s awards event will feature over 100 high school student performers, singers and musicians representing 74 area schools who will be recognized in several performance categories including Outstanding Performer, Outstanding Choral Performance, Outstanding Solo Performance and Outstanding Student Reporter. Additionally, the New York City Center will be introducing an Outstanding Scenic and Costume Design Award and selecting a student orchestra to perform at the event.

Judges for this years’ Outstanding Performer award includes Erich Bergen (actor/singer); Kiara Brown Clark (teaching artist, Disney Theatrical Group); Jenny Gersten (director and producer, New York City Center); Baayork Lee, (actress, director/choreographer), Merri Sugarman (casting director, Tara Rubin Casting); Tom Viertel (Tony Award-winning producer; Producer of Back to the Future).

The Roger Rees Awards is the Greater New York Regional Award for The Broadway League Foundation’s National High School Musical Theatre Awards aka The Jimmy Awards®.
